Understanding the Basics of Abrasion Resistant Steel

Abrasion resistant steel grades are classified primarily based on their hardness and impact resistance. The hardness of these steels is measured using the Brinell hardness test, with many abrasion resistant steels falling within the range of 450 to 600 HB. This specific hardness rating allows these materials to offer exceptional performance in environments prone to high abrasion.

Hardness and Toughness

While hardness is a vital factor, toughness must also be considered when choosing steel. Toughness is the ability of the material to absorb energy and deform plastically without fracturing. Some applications may demand abrasion resistant steel grades that provide a balance between hardness and toughness, particularly in environments where impact loads are prevalent.

Weldability and Formability

Different grades of abrasion resistant steel will have varying levels of weldability. Some applications may require these materials to be welded or formed into specific shapes, thus necessitating the need for steel grades that are easier to fabricate without losing their abrasion resistant properties. Manufacturers often produce specific formulations that cater to these demands.

Abrasion resistant steel grades find use in a wide range of industries due to their durability and strength.

Mining and Construction

One of the primary industries utilizing these steel grades is mining. Equipment such as bucket bodies, crushers, and excavators are frequently exposed to abrasive materials. Utilizing the right abrasion resistant steel grades ensures that these tools maintain integrity and reduce downtime from wear.

Agriculture

In the agricultural sector, abrasion resistant steel is essential in equipment such as plows and tillers, which operate in rough ground conditions. The use of durable steel helps in reducing maintenance costs and increasing operational lifetime.

Transportation

Transportation industries also benefit from abrasion resistant steel grades in the construction of trucks and rail components. By using high-performance steel, manufacturers can create vehicles that last longer and operate more efficiently, minimizing the risk of operational failures.
